March Weather in Mons, Belgium

Last updated: August 21, 2025

March in Mons, Belgium is characterized by a dynamic climate marked by fluctuating temperatures and notable precipitation. The month sees a maximum temperature reaching up to 23°C (73°F), juxtaposed with an average of 7°C (45°F) and occasional lows plunging to -9°C (17°F). With 74 mm (2.9 in) of rain falling over 14 days, the weather can be quite wet, contributing to a high humidity level of 87%. This variability encapsulates the essence of early spring in Mons, where cool breezes and intermittent showers create a refreshing atmosphere in preparation for the warmer months ahead.

Daylight Hours in Mons in March

As March arrives in Mons, Belgium, residents begin to enjoy an increase in daylight, with the hours stretching to 11 hours compared to just 8 hours in January. This gradual lengthening of daylight becomes more pronounced as spring approaches, bringing a sense of renewal and warmth. Each month leading to the solstice sees a steady rise, peaking in June with a robust 16 hours of daylight. After that, the hours will gently recede, offering a cyclical dance of light and dark throughout the year. March Winds in Mons

In March, Mons, Belgium experiences a gentle breeze, with an average wind speed of 4.0 m/s (9 mph). This marks a slight dip from the previous months, where January and February consistently boasted higher speeds of 4.3 m/s and 4.6 m/s, respectively. As spring approaches, the winds begin to soften, foreshadowing the calmer air of April, which sees a further decrease to 3.4 m/s (8 mph).
